How to suspend an account in Web Host Manager.
Posted by admin on 11 September 2009 10:21 PM
WebHost Manager enables you to suspend problematic accounts. Suspension simply means that no web site pages are served to accounts, no FTP connections are accepted, and all email is blocked. Suspension is the first step in dealing with problematic accounts.

Log into Web Host Manager and click on account functions.
Click on Suspend/Unsuspend an Account.
Click on the required domain or user name in the displayed list.
If you are suspending an account, enter a brief description of why the account is being suspended in the field next to Reason.
Click on the Suspend button to suspend the account.

Please note: If the account you are suspending belongs to a reseller, you can disallow the reseller from unsuspending it with the check box, "Disallow resellers from unsuspending".
